| available() const | circular_queue< T, ForEachArg > | inlineprotected |
| available_for_push() const | circular_queue< T, ForEachArg > | inlineprotected |
| capacity(const size_t cap) | circular_queue_mp< T, ForEachArg > | inline |
| circular_queue::capacity() const | circular_queue< T, ForEachArg > | inlineprotected |
| circular_queue() | circular_queue< T, ForEachArg > | inlineprotected |
| circular_queue(const size_t capacity) | circular_queue< T, ForEachArg > | inlineprotected |
| circular_queue(circular_queue &&cq) | circular_queue< T, ForEachArg > | inlineprotected |
| circular_queue(const circular_queue &)=delete | circular_queue< T, ForEachArg > | protected |
| circular_queue_mp()=default | circular_queue_mp< T, ForEachArg > | |
| circular_queue_mp(const size_t capacity) | circular_queue_mp< T, ForEachArg > | inline |
| circular_queue_mp(circular_queue< T, ForEachArg > &&cq) | circular_queue_mp< T, ForEachArg > | inline |
| defaultValue | circular_queue< T, ForEachArg > | protected |
| flush() | circular_queue< T, ForEachArg > | inlineprotected |
| for_each(const Delegate< void(T &&), ForEachArg > &fun) | circular_queue< T, ForEachArg > | protected |
| for_each(Delegate< void(T &&), ForEachArg > fun) | circular_queue< T, ForEachArg > | protected |
| for_each_requeue(const Delegate< bool(T &), ForEachArg > &fun) | circular_queue_mp< T, ForEachArg > | |
| for_each_rev_requeue(const Delegate< bool(T &), ForEachArg > &fun) | circular_queue< T, ForEachArg > | protected |
| for_each_rev_requeue(Delegate< bool(T &), ForEachArg > fun) | circular_queue< T, ForEachArg > | protected |
| m_buffer | circular_queue< T, ForEachArg > | protected |
| m_buffer | circular_queue< T, ForEachArg > | protected |
| m_bufSize | circular_queue< T, ForEachArg > | protected |
| m_inPos | circular_queue< T, ForEachArg > | protected |
| m_outPos | circular_queue< T, ForEachArg > | protected |
| m_pushMtx | circular_queue_mp< T, ForEachArg > | protected |
| operator=(circular_queue &&cq) | circular_queue< T, ForEachArg > | inlineprotected |
| operator=(const circular_queue &)=delete | circular_queue< T, ForEachArg > | protected |
| peek() const | circular_queue< T, ForEachArg > | inlineprotected |
| pop() | circular_queue< T, ForEachArg > | protected |
| pop_n(T *buffer, size_t size) | circular_queue< T, ForEachArg > | protected |
| pop_requeue() | circular_queue_mp< T, ForEachArg > | |
| push()=delete | circular_queue_mp< T, ForEachArg > | |
| push(T &&val) | circular_queue_mp< T, ForEachArg > | inline |
| push(const T &val) | circular_queue_mp< T, ForEachArg > | inline |
| push_n(const T *buffer, size_t size) | circular_queue_mp< T, ForEachArg > | inline |
| pushpeek() __attribute__((always_inline)) | circular_queue< T, ForEachArg > | inlineprotected |
| ~circular_queue() | circular_queue< T, ForEachArg > | inlineprotected |